Independent Contractor Status "Hanson.xyz shall perform all work under this agreement as an independent contractor. Nothing herein shall be construed to create a partnership, joint venture, or employer-employee relationship between the parties." 2. Governing Law and Jurisdiction "This agreement shall be governed by and construed in accordance with the laws of the State of Minnesota. Any legal action or proceeding arising under this agreement shall be brought exclusively in the courts located within the State of Minnesota." 3. Intellectual Property and Work Product - Client owns all work product upon full payment - Developer grants perpetual license to use - Developer retains rights to pre-existing tools/frameworks - Consultant Tools provision for reusable code libraries 4. Warranty "The Developer will guarantee their services for 60 days after the completion of the project. During this warranty period, the Developer will provide any necessary fixes to functionality provided within the 'Scope of work' at no additional cost. After the expiration of the warranty period, any additional changes, modifications, or support for the functionality provided will be quoted separately from this agreement." 5. Limitation of Liability "Hanson.xyz's liability for any claim arising out of this agreement shall not exceed the total compensation paid under this agreement. In no event shall Hanson.xyz be liable for any consequential, incidental, special, or punitive damages, including lost profits or business interruption." 6. Indemnification "Each party shall indemnify and hold the other harmless from any third-party claims resulting from its own gross negligence or intentional misconduct in connection with this agreement." 7. Change Requests "After the scope of work has been agreed upon, any changes requested by the Client to the scope of work must be approved in writing by both parties before they can be implemented. The Developer will provide a quote at the rate of $250 per hour for the work, and the Client will pay the additional fee as specified in the quote. The Developer will not begin any additional work until the Client has approved the quote in writing." 8. Confidentiality "Both parties agree to keep the details of this contract and the project confidential, except as otherwise agreed in writing. Any information or materials shared by the Client with the Developer for the purposes of this project will be treated as confidential and will not be disclosed to any third party without the prior written consent of the disclosing party. The Client grants the Developer the right to showcase the completed project within their portfolio, subject to the Client's approval of the final product and any necessary confidentiality agreement." 9. Entire Agreement and Modifications "This document represents the full and complete agreement between the parties. Any modifications or amendments must be made in writing and signed by both parties." 10. Severability "If any provision of this agreement is found to be invalid or unenforceable, the remaining provisions shall continue in full force and effect." 11. Delivery Timeline Disclaimer "The developer will make every reasonable effort to deliver the project within the timeline specified. In the event of unforeseen delays, the client agrees not to hold the developer liable for exceeding the estimated delivery schedule. However, if the project is not delivered within a reasonable timeframe, the client reserves the right to terminate this agreement at their discretion."
